Nintendo Blocks Amazon US Sales
- Nintendo has removed its products from Amazon U.S. due to conflicts over third-party sellers discounting Nintendo products.
- The Switch 2 was deliberately stocked only at Target, Walmart, and Best Buy in the U.S., not Amazon.
Canada Drops Digital Tax Plan
- Canada canceled its digital services tax on U.S. tech firms, easing trade tensions with the U.S.
- The tax would have imposed a 3% revenue levy on companies like Amazon and Google for earnings from Canadian users.
